    What is the JEE Exam Pattern?

    The NTA/National Testing Agency runs JEE Main. For B.E./B.Tech. (Paper-1), each subject - Mathematics, Physics, Chemistry - has 20 MCQs in Section A and 5 numerical questions in Section B, giving 25 questions per subject, 75 questions in total for 300 marks. Each correct answer earns +4, each wrong MCQ or wrong numerical answer gets -1 and unanswered questions score 0. The exam is computer-based and is held twice a year, with the best NTA score of the two sessions used for ranking.

    Why does this matter? The presence of numerical-type questions and negative marking means accuracy matters - wild guessing is a losing strategy.

    Subject Section A (MCQs) Section B (Numerical) Total Questions Marks
    Mathematics 20 5 25 100
    Physics 20 5 25 100
    Chemistry 20 5 25 100
    Overall 60 15 75 300

     

    Marking Scheme:

    • Correct answer: +4
    • Wrong answer (MCQ or numerical): −1
    • Unanswered: 0

    What Are the Expected JEE Main 2027 Exam Dates and Timeline?

    NTA hasn't released the official JEE Main 2027 information bulletin yet — it's expected around late October or November 2026, along with Session 1 registration. Based on the pattern followed for the last three cycles, here's what to plan around. Bookmark the official JEE Main website and check back once the information bulletin drops — treat the table below as planning guidance, not confirmed dates.

    Event Expected Timeline
    Session 1 registration opens October-November 2026
    Session 1 exam Last week of January 2027
    Session 1 result February 2027
    Session 2 registration February-March 2027
    Session 2 exam First week of April 2027
    Session 2 result April 2027

     

    For scale- 16,04,854 unique candidates registered for JEE Main 2026 across both sessions and 2,50,182 candidates qualified for JEE Advanced, with the general category cutoff at 93.41 percentile. Competition is only rising year on year, which is exactly why a structured plan matters more than raw study hours.

    First Mission: Build a Rock-Solid Foundation (0-3 months)

    Objective: Finish NCERT and make sure the concepts don’t wobble.

    • Start with NCERT: Read and solve NCERT examples and exercise questions for Physics, Chemistry and Maths. For many JEE topics, NCERT supplies the foundational language of questions and is to be strictly followed.
    • Make a short syllabus checklist: Download the official syllabus and tick the topics as you complete them. The NTA syllabus is definitive - use it to avoid wasted time on irrelevant topics.
    • Create “concept notes”: One A4 page per chapter with formulae, key derivations, exception rules (when does Hooke’s law break down? which reactions need special attention?) and a small 5-question practice set. Keep these for rapid revision.
    • Daily rhythm (2–3 hours study if you’re in school and 4–6 if full-time): 60% new learning plus 40% problem practice. Active recall beats passive reading.

    Tip: Don’t drown in too many reference books at this stage. NCERT + one reliable coaching module or standard reference book per subject is ideal for foundations.

    Upshift: Targeted Problem Practice (3–8 months)

    Objective: Convert concept knowledge into speed and accuracy.

    • Subject blocks: Alternate 2-3 day deep blocks for each subject (e.g., Mon–Tue Physics, Wed–Thu Maths, Fri–Sun Chemistry). During blocks, practise only problems from that subject.
    • Choose quality question sources: Standard problem books and previous years’ JEE Main papers. For Physics, include conceptual and numerical; for Maths, practice problem types (algebra, calculus, coordinate geometry) repeatedly; for Chemistry, split inorganic (memorise smartly), organic (mechanisms/patterns) and physical (numerical practice).
    • Make error logs: Record every mistake with explanation and the correct method. Revisit error lists weekly — that’s where the jump in score happens.
    • Timed practice: Start with topic-wise timed sets, then move to full 3-hour sections. Simulate exam interface occasionally (CBT feel).

    Tip: Make a “frequent-ask” list of typical JEE traps you fall into (unit mix-ups, sign errors, omitting limits on integrals) and add the trap-fix to your daily warm-up.

    Mock Tests & Strategy Lab (8–16 weeks)

    Objective: Convert raw practice into exam performance.

    • Weekly mock tests: Take one full mock every week under strict exam conditions. Analyse thoroughly - not just score but time per question, abandoned questions and topic weak spots.
    • Shift strategy: Because JEE is CBT and has numerical questions, decide your target approach: attempt high-confidence MCQs first, flag moderate ones, solve numericals carefully in a separate pass. Practice the order until it’s automatic.
    • Score normalisation awareness: NTA conducts multi-shifts; your rank depends on NTA scoring and best-of-two sessions (if you sit both). Practise across difficulty levels and conditions to build robustness.
    • Targeted drills: If a mock shows you losing time on calculus, schedule a 2-week focused drill on that subtopic.

    Tip: Never ignore the post-mock correction. The one-page corrected analysis (what went wrong and how to fix it) is worth more than the test.

    Subject-Wise Game Plans (Short, Sharp and Actionable)

    Make Physics Your Playground (Think Experiments, Not Memorisation)

    • Master concepts first: Kinematics, electrostatics, modern physics — understand what each law means.
    • Solve concept questions before lengthy numericals. If you can explain an effect in one sentence, you’ll solve the problem faster.
    • Use past JEE papers to learn the style of application questions.

    Maths: From Repetition to Intuition

    • Drill core topics: Algebra (polynomials/equations), coordinate geometry, calculus (limits, derivatives, integrals), vectors.
    • Build a formula index but prioritise derivations — if you can derive, you won’t forget.
    • Practice full papers to build speed: Many marks are a reward for faster, error-free execution.

    Chemistry: Divide and Rule

    • Physical Chemistry: Practise numericals until problem patterns are second nature.
    • Organic: Learn mechanisms as predictable flows; practise named reactions as tools.
    • Inorganic: Memorise selectively - focus on periodic trends, common reactions and exceptions. NCERT is king here.

    Which Chapters Have the Highest Weightage in JEE Main 2027?

    Not all chapters carry equal weight. Spending equal time everywhere is one of the most common ways aspirants waste their limited prep window. Based on trends from recent JEE Main papers, here's where the marks concentrate-

    Physics

    High-weightage Areas Typical Share
    Electrostatics, Current Electricity, Magnetism 20-25%
    Modern Physics (Atoms, Nuclei, Dual Nature) 10-12%
    Mechanics (Laws of Motion, Rotational Motion, WEP) 15-18%
    Optics (Ray + Wave) 10-13%

     

    Chemistry

    High-weightage Areas Typical Share
    Coordination Compounds, d/f-Block 13-15%
    Organic - GOC, Aldehydes/Ketones/Carboxylic Acids 15-18%
    Physical Chemistry - Thermodynamics, Equilibrium, Kinetics 15-18%

     

    Mathematics

    High-weightage Areas Typical Share
    Coordinate Geometry 15-18%
    Calculus (Limits, Continuity, Integrals) 18-20%
    Algebra (Matrices, Complex Numbers, P&C) 15-18%

     

    Always refer to the NTA syllabus PDF released with the Information Bulletin for the official, exam-defining syllabus. Use third-party chapter-weightage charts only to prioritise your preparation, not as a substitute for covering the complete syllabus.

    The Last 30 / 7 / 1 Days: A Pragmatic Checklist

    Last 30 days

    • Finish rapid revision of concept notes and solved error log.
    • Switch full focus to mocks: 2-3 full mocks per week + focused correction.
    • Lighten new learning: You should mostly revise and practice.

    Last 7 days

    • Do 2 full mocks (not back-to-back). Do only light practice otherwise.
    • Finalise exam logistics: Admit card, ID, travel plan and exam city details (Admit cards are released on the official NTA site a few days before the exam).
    • Sleep early, keep hydrated and eat simple food.

    Last 24 hours

    • Don’t study new topics. Review formula sheets and one or two short concept notes. Pack essentials like admit card, ID, water bottle and anything as required.

    Exam-Day Execution: Calm, Precise, Efficient

    • Read the paper’s instructions slowly. Note the on-screen navigation for numerical answers. The NTA CBT uses an on-screen numeric keypad for Section B — practise that in mocks.
    • Do a quick scan (10–15 minutes): Mark 15–20 straight-answer questions you can do fast.
    • Keep to your timing plan:g., first pass 60–75% of paper (quick solves), second pass medium difficulty, final pass numericals and flagged items.
    • Avoid wild guessing because negative marking applies. If you can eliminate one or two options on an MCQ, the expected value may justify an educated guess; otherwise, skip and return later.

    How Many Questions Should You Actually Attempt?

    There is no fixed number of questions you should attempt in JEE Main 2027. Because incorrect answers carry negative marking, accuracy is often more important than attempting more questions. As a practical mock-test benchmark, you can use the following ranges-

    Questions Attempted Accuracy Needed Approx. Score Range
    60-65 95%+ 230-250
    65-75 90-93% 210-235
    75-85 85-88% 190-215

     

    The key takeaway- Attempting 65 questions with 95% accuracy can be more effective than attempting 85 questions with 80% accuracy. Use your mock tests to identify the right attempt-and-accuracy balance for your preparation rather than following a fixed attempt target on exam day.

    What Are the Best Resources to Prepare for JEE Main 2027?

    The best JEE Main 2027 preparation resources include the official NTA syllabus and Information Bulletin, NCERT textbooks, previous years' question papers, mock tests and a limited number of trusted reference books. Use the following resources based on your preparation needs-

    Category Recommended Resources
    Official Resources NTA JEE Main Information Bulletin and official syllabus - use these as the primary source for the exam pattern, syllabus and requirements.
    Foundation & Practice NCERT textbooks for Classes 11 and 12; JEE Main previous years' question papers available through official sources; and reliable mock tests from reputed coaching institutes or trusted providers.
    Reference Books Physics: H.C. Verma or D.C. Pandey Mathematics: R.D. Sharma or Arihant series Chemistry: O.P. Tandon; Morrison and Boyd for Organic Chemistry; NCERT for Inorganic Chemistry.

    Preparation Tip- Avoid collecting too many books. Choose one primary reference book per subject, complete NCERT and previous years' questions and use additional resources only when you need more practice or conceptual clarity.

    How to Prepare for JEE Main 2027 in 12 Weeks?

    A 12-week JEE Main 2027 study plan should progress from concept building and syllabus coverage to timed practice, mock tests and final revision. Adjust the schedule according to your preparation level and exam date.

    Weeks What to Focus On
    Weeks 1-4 Complete NCERT and high-priority chapters. Build concepts and prepare concise revision notes.
    Weeks 5-8 Practise topic-wise questions, begin timed chapter tests and take one full mock test each week.
    Weeks 9-11 Take 2 full-length mocks per week, analyse mistakes, update your error log and revise weak topics.
    Week 12 Focus on light revision, take 2 final mocks, review important formulas and concepts and prioritise proper rest before the exam.

    Key tip: Don't simply count study hours. Track syllabus completed, questions solved, mock-test accuracy and recurring mistakes to measure your JEE Main preparation progress.

    How Should Droppers Prepare for JEE Main 2027?

    Droppers preparing for JEE Main 2027 should focus less on repeating the basics and more on identifying gaps, improving accuracy and speed, practising PYQs and analysing mock-test performance. A structured dropper strategy can help you use the extra preparation time more effectively.

    • Start with a Diagnostic Test- Attempt a previous JEE Main paper or mock and identify conceptual, calculation, careless or time-management errors.
    • Prioritise Practice- If your basics are strong, focus on PYQs, timed practice and targeted revision instead of rereading chapters.
    • Take Regular Mocks- Gradually increase mock-test frequency and analyse incorrect, guessed and unattempted questions.
    • Maintain an Error Log- Track recurring mistakes and review them regularly to avoid repeating them.
    • Balance Preparation and Recovery- Follow realistic study targets, take regular breaks and get adequate sleep for consistent preparation.

    Key Takeaway- A successful JEE Main dropper strategy is not about studying everything again. It is about finding what went wrong in the previous attempt, fixing those gaps and converting practice into better accuracy and speed.

    What Common Mistakes Should You Avoid When Preparing for JEE Main 2027?

    Avoid these common JEE Main preparation mistakes-

    • Relying only on shortcuts- Build concept clarity first so you can solve unfamiliar questions.
    • Ignoring actual JEE Main papers- Practise previous years’ papers along with coaching tests to understand the real exam pattern and question style.
    • Cramming before the exam- Avoid all-nighters. Proper sleep and rest can help you stay focused and perform consistently on exam day.
